The ability to remember shapes our identities and influences our relationships with others. Remembering refers to the cognitive process of retrieving and recalling past experiences, information, or events that have been previously learned or encountered. It is a critical function of the brain associated with consciousness and awareness that facilitates learning, recognition, and planning. James 1 NIV - James, a servant of God and of the Lord - Bible Gateway Title and Author: The book is traditionally attributed to James, the brother of Jesus, also known as James the Just. He was a prominent leader in the early Christian church in Jerusalem. The Epistle of James is a public letter (epistle), and includes an epistolary prescript that identifies the sender ("James") and the recipients ("to the twelve tribes in the diaspora") and provides a greeting (James 1:1). Life-forms present on Earth today have evolved from ancient common ancestors through the generation of hereditary variation and natural selection. Life exists all over the Earth in air, water, and soil, with many ecosystems forming the biosphere. Some of these are harsh environments occupied only by extremophiles. All living organisms (biotic) share eight key characteristics or functions: order, sensitivity or response to stimuli, reproduction, growth and development, regulation and homeostasis, energy processing, adaptation, and evolution. When viewed together, these characteristics serve to define life. A difficult term to define, life can be considered the characteristic state of living organisms and individual cells, or that quality or property that distinguishes living organisms from dead organisms and inanimate objects.
